What is the equation for variable y 6x-12y=18 ?

If you solve for y, it is equal to 1/2x - 3/2

In order to find this, follow the order of operations to isolate y.

6x - 12y = 18 ----> subtract 6x from both sides

-12y = -6x + 18 -----> Divide by -12

y = 1/2x -3/2
